How are steak and dashi different?

  • Steak is richer in vitamin B12, zinc, vitamin B6, iron, and vitamin B3, while dashi is higher in vitamin K and calcium.
  • Steak covers your daily need for vitamin B12, 79% more than dashi.
  • Steak contains 70 times more zinc than dashi. Steak contains 6.34mg of zinc, while dashi contains 0.09mg.
  • Dashi is lower in cholesterol.

Beef, rib eye steak, boneless, lip off, separable lean, and fat, trimmed to 0" fat, all grades, cooked, grilled and Soup, bouillon cubes, and granules, low sodium, dry types were used in this article.
